The Kingdom Hearts series consists of many prequels and side-games. To better experience the feel of the games; it is best to play the games in the order that they were released. The games are as follows: Kingdom Hearts (PS2) Kingdom Hearts: Chain of Memories/RE: C.O.M. (GBA/PS2) Kingdom Hearts II (PS2) Kingdom Hearts 358/2 Days (DS) Kingdom Hearts Birth By Sleep (PSP) Kingdom Hearts Coded/Re:coded

Kingdom Hearts is an entity formed from the gathering of hearts. Hearts gather into Kingdom Hearts when Heartles and Nobodies are vanquished with the power of the keyblade (otherwise the hearts would just reform into Heartless again). Kingdom Hearts was originally thought to be a dark or evil entity, but as Sora learned from his adventures in the first game; "Kingdom Hearts is light".

That would be Utada Hikaru. She is the singer of the Kingdom Hearts theme songs. (Simple and Clean/Sanctuary)
